A full-circle moment for the Melodyman

Frontliner, a true icon of the Hardstyle scene, is officially back at SCANTRAXX! The mastermind behind timeless tracks like "Symbols", "Weekend Warriors", and "I’m The Melodyman" launches a new chapter with the introduction of his very own label: This Is Hardstyle.

The return of a pioneer

Back in 2008, a young Frontliner made his SCANTRAXX debut with "Tuuduu" and "Rock That Thing". From there, he carved a path defined by melody, emotion, and an unmistakable connection with crowds. But the story starts even earlier: in 2007, he released tracks under the alias Abject, including "End Of My Existence" and "Scantraxx Rootz", the latter becoming the unofficial anthem of SCANTRAXX!

Now, in 2025, he returns to the place where it all began, this time with creative control and a vision of his own.

“SCANTRAXX gave me my first real shot. Coming back now, with my own label, just felt right.”

This Is Hardstyle - by name and by nature

Launched as a platform to spotlight euphoric Hardstyle, This Is Hardstyle is Frontliner’s answer to a scene that, in his words, “needed more melody, more emotion, and more pure energy.” It’s not just about his own tracks, it’s a home for artists who believe Hardstyle can be both powerful and uplifting.

The label kicks off strong with its debut release, You Made It, dropping this Friday, May 16th. The track is an upbeat summer anthem that radiates optimism and carries Frontliner’s unmistakable melodic touch.

“It’s about celebrating who we are. About not caring what anyone thinks and just enjoying the music.”

What’s coming next?

Plenty. With over 100 releases to his name and six albums under his belt, Frontliner’s work ethic hasn’t slowed, and neither has his inspiration.

Expect upcoming collabs with Aftershock, Outsiders, Reinier Zonneveld, and more B-Frontliner projects. Plus, a remix of Showtek’s "Music On My Mind" and even a few surprises from his Alter Ego alias.

“2025 is going to be wild. I’ve never felt more inspired.”
